Ventos de Sao Roque 08 is a 49.5MW onshore wind power project. It is located in Piaui, Brazil. According to GlobalData, who tracks and profiles over 170,000 power plants worldwide, the project is currently active. It has been developed in a single phase. Description

The project was developed by Enel Green Power Ventos de Sao Roque 08 and is currently owned by Enel Americas with a stake of 100%.

The project cost is $76.725m.

Development status

The project is currently active. The project got commissioned in October 2022.

Contractors involved

GE Renewable Energy was selected as the turbine supplier for the wind power project. The company provided 9 units of 5.3-158 MW turbines, each with 5.5MW nameplate capacity.
